Jean-Pierre Pernaut suffering from lung cancer: Nathalie Marquay makes a “shameful” revelation

The news struck like a bombshell. Already recovered from heavy prostate cancer in 2018, Jean-Pierre Pernaut revealed that he was once again ill this Monday, November 22, 2021. The 71-year-old journalist is this time affected. lung cancer. Last July, he even had a successful operation on the right side, but unfortunately a month later he learned that it was the left side that was now affected and for which it was impossible to operate. It is therefore via radiotherapy that he is trying to fight the disease.
